Output 1035409a263e5584272eb7b998b38f742a522ceb184349d26b4e7a281fead7b9: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6edd4b356397a930edbd4bc6c7a903546b36c447 OP_EQUAL
address
3BoDMQYUmf81kY4M2qU9RqpzcbdbFvuBqy
transaction
1035409a263e5584272eb7b998b38f742a522ceb184349d26b4e7a281fead7b9
spent
true